A community panel discussion presented by the University of Regina's Faculty of Arts.About this Event
Join the conversation as panelists discuss how local plans for reducing carbon emissions can contribute to climate justice in our community.
Panelists include:
- Robbie Humble, Manager of Sustainable Energy and Adaptation at the City of Regina
- Neil Paskewitz, Associate Vice-President of Facilities Management at the University of Regina
- Abhay Singh Sachal, Graduate Student at the University of Regina and Founder of Break The Divide
- Dr. Jennie Stephens, Professor of Climate Justice at the National University of Ireland Maynooth
- Moderated by Jocelyn Crivea, Director of the Sustainability Office at the University of Regina
